Zoloft is a Class C medication which means that studies in animals show it does not harm the fetus but no adequate studies are documented in humans.  Birth defects etc are a non-issue when taking Zoloft after the 1st trimester.  When taking an SSRI your baby might suffer  withdrawal symptoms after birth and will be monitored for that - you are on a relatively small dosage so there is a good chance this will not happen (or will be very minimal).

You can also ask your doctor about vistaril - this will help control any panic attacks you might have during the remainder of your pregnancy if you still have some problems with them.  It is the pregnancy-safe version of Xanax.
